NIRVANA
COME AS YOU ARE (THE DIRTY FUNKER REMIXES)
SPIRIT

After injecting life into Kurt’s ‘Lithium’, the master alchemist of bastard pop turns his (or maybe her) attention to yet another classic from the Seattle superstar’s locker – 1992’s ‘Come As You Are’. Little has changed in the Club Mix with a syncopated beat tightening up the strumming of Cobain and Krist Novoselic, with Dave Grohl’s drums now beating to a 4/4 rhythm. But the real fun starts on the Dub that allows the DF to use more imagination and less Nirvana, transforming the track into an electronica delight that rides an altogether starker backdrop for the odd lyrical drop.
